Peter Gostomski is a scholar working on Process Chemistry and Technology, Pollution and Environmental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Peter Gostomski has authored 43 papers receiving a total of 474 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 16 papers in Process Chemistry and Technology, 13 papers in Pollution and 10 papers in Environmental Engineering. Recurrent topics in Peter Gostomski's work include Odor and Emission Control Technologies (16 papers), Wastewater Treatment and Nitrogen Removal (13 papers) and Microbial Fuel Cells and Bioremediation (8 papers). Peter Gostomski is often cited by papers focused on Odor and Emission Control Technologies (16 papers), Wastewater Treatment and Nitrogen Removal (13 papers) and Microbial Fuel Cells and Bioremediation (8 papers). Peter Gostomski collaborates with scholars based in New Zealand, United States and Japan. Peter Gostomski's co-authors include David G. Wareham, Aisling D. O’Sullivan, Henry R. Bungay, Achinta Bordoloi, Robert Cherry, J. B. Sisson, Aaron T. Marshall, Evelyn Evelyn, Yan Li and Andreas Duenser and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Water Research and Chemical Engineering Journal.
